Output 83ca9257162caf6a68e577e1eee6bf660e970081a2c23f398b892d7717854491:3

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 9b6f7b15e0085604c3925aeec7aac9bd3c0f97f6
address
bc1qndhhk90qpptqfsujtthv02kfh57ql9lk869sue
transaction
83ca9257162caf6a68e577e1eee6bf660e970081a2c23f398b892d7717854491
spent
true